I don't think so . Bounty hunters earn their tokens by doing a job , they don't invest any money there , so they can not lose money by definition and can wait for a suitable price for sale as long as it would be needed , without any risks to incur financial losses . While ICO investors , who bought tokens by paying a fiat money have a risk to lose everything if token will become useless and will worth 0 , and if price start to decrease they might want to sell it at any price as soon as possible to reduce their losses .

Some teams are very clever when blocking coins for several months, so that the hunters do not bring down the coin at the first moment as it appears on the exchange. Or pay bounty hunters in several stages. I'm not selling anything yet, I'm just waiting for the market to grow.
